solve the following equation for x:
$4 = -9x - 8$
enter your answer as an improper fraction, if necessary. do not include \x =\ in your answer.
provide your answer below:
Step1: Add 8 to both sides
To isolate the term with \( x \), we add 8 to both sides of the equation \( 4 = -9x - 8 \). This gives \( 4 + 8 = -9x - 8 + 8 \), which simplifies to \( 12 = -9x \).
Step2: Divide both sides by -9
Now, we divide both sides of the equation \( 12 = -9x \) by -9 to solve for \( x \). So, \( x=\frac{12}{-9} \), and simplifying the fraction (dividing numerator and denominator by their greatest common divisor, which is 3) gives \( x = -\frac{4}{3} \).
